test(core): add FeedSource integration tests
Tests graph validation (dependency existence, cycle detection, topological sort) and refresh behavior (context accumulation, item collection). Co-authored-by: Ona <no-reply@ona.com>

function buildGraph(sources: FeedSource[]): SourceGraph {
|
||||
const byId = new Map<string, FeedSource>()
|
||||
for (const source of sources) {
|
||||
byId.set(source.id, source)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Validate dependencies exist
|
||||
for (const source of sources) {
|
||||
for (const dep of source.dependencies ?? []) {
|
||||
if (!byId.has(dep)) {
|
||||
throw new Error(`Source "${source.id}" depends on "${dep}" which is not registered`)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Check for cycles and topologically sort
|
||||
const visited = new Set<string>()
|
||||
const visiting = new Set<string>()
|
||||
const sorted: FeedSource[] = []
|
||||
|
||||
function visit(id: string, path: string[]): void {
|
||||
if (visiting.has(id)) {
|
||||
const cycle = [...path.slice(path.indexOf(id)), id].join(" → ")
|
||||
throw new Error(`Circular dependency detected: ${cycle}`)
|
||||
}
|
||||
if (visited.has(id)) return
|
||||
|
||||
visiting.add(id)
|
||||
const source = byId.get(id)!
|
||||
for (const dep of source.dependencies ?? []) {
|
||||
visit(dep, [...path, id])
|
||||
}
|
||||
visiting.delete(id)
|
||||
visited.add(id)
|
||||
sorted.push(source)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
for (const source of sources) {
|
||||
visit(source.id, [])
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Build reverse dependency map
|
||||
const dependents = new Map<string, string[]>()
|
||||
for (const source of sources) {
|
||||
for (const dep of source.dependencies ?? []) {
|
||||
const list = dependents.get(dep) ?? []
|
||||
list.push(source.id)
|
||||
dependents.set(dep, list)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return { sources: byId, sorted, dependents }
|
||||
}
